Bauchi State Governor, Bala Abdulkadir Mohammed on Tuesday flagged off empowerment programe for beneficiaries in Ganjuwa and Darazo Local Government Areas of the state.

The governor said the empowerment program under the Kaura Economic Empowerment Programme (KEEP) is a deliberate effort to holistically address the problem of unemployment and poverty in the state especially among youth and women.

While speaking at the Flags-Off ceremony,the Governor said his administration is desirous of pulling the majority of the people of the state out of poverty.

He said items covered for the empowerment include, provision of stater packs and fifty thousand naira cash for five hundred persons per local government, provision of three motorcycles in each of the wards of the twenty local governments for ward chairmen, ward coordinators and ward youth leaders as beneficiaries.

Others he said are the provision of one hundred thousand Nairah cash to women and youth leaders in each of the twenty local governments as well as the provision of five buses to each of the local government areas of the state.

“Today’s occasion is a continuation of the formal launching of the programme in all the 20 Local Government Areas of the state.These items are just part of the package the State Government earmarked for its empowerment programme.”

“We are determined to give the necessary support to our poverty alleviation and economic empowerment agencies to effectively and efficiently discharge their responsibilities.”

He also announced plans by the state government to support artisans and traders across the state with five hundred million naira as soft loan to advance their business activities.

Governor Bala Mohammed therefore reassured the people of the state that his administration is irrevocably committed to the upliftment of their condition of living through various economic empowerment programmes and appealed for continued support and cooperation towards the realization of the noble objective.

Commenting on the criticism by his opponents against irregularities in the payment of salaries in the state, the governor said the state government has taken the necessary measures to restore sanity in the system.

He said as a government that believed in accountability and transparency, his administration will not fold it arms and watch public funds being siphoned by some unscruplans civil servants.

The state first lady, Hajiya Aisha Bala Mohammed who was highly delighted to be part of the occasion, applauded the support of Governor Bala Mohammed to women and youth across the state.

On his part, the State PDP Chairman Hamza Koshe Akuyam, said the governor’s empowerment programme is part of the manifestor of the People’s Democratic Party (PDP) to tackle poverty and unemployment.
